Re: In Arnie We Trust
The big question is, should Chauncey sit?
I think he should if he's not 100%. If he's playing at less than 100% and tweaks something that could keep him out for awhile, plus he might not get back to 100% without the rest.
As much as the Pistons would like to win this game, it's not a must win game. A 100% healthy Chauncey will be absolutely essential if the Pistons can get out of this round (which they should).
